<h3 id="grasping-registered-agents-role" id="grasping-registered-agents-role">Grasping Registered Agents&#39; Role</h3>

<p>A designated representative serves a essential role in the existence of a commercial entity. Acting as <a href="http://www.supergame.one/home.php?mod=space&amp;uid=1016492">registered agent compliance</a> of contact for legal and tax documents, the registered agent makes certain that important messages are received in a timely manner. This might include court documents, which alert the entity of legal proceedings or legal actions. By having a registered agent, businesses can uphold compliance with state regulations while ensuring that important legal papers are handled appropriately.</p>

<p>In numerous areas, having a registered agent is a legal requirement for companies and limited liability companies. The registered agent must have a location in the state of formation, where they can receive and handle documents on behalf of the business. This requirement helps maintain transparency within the business landscape, as it provides a trustworthy method of communication between the state and the entity, thus enabling businesses to stay compliant with statutory obligations.</p>

<h3 id="pricing-and-fees-of-registered-agent-solutions" id="pricing-and-fees-of-registered-agent-solutions">Pricing and Fees of Registered Agent Solutions</h3>

<p>When considering agent services, understanding the expenses and fees involved is important for organizations of various sizes. Typically, registered agent costs can vary from around $50 to 300 USD annually, based on the agent company and the package details. Cost factors may consist of extra features such as reminders for compliance, document handling, and digital access to critical updates. Businesses should carefully evaluate what is included in each package to ensure they are getting the highest return for their own needs.</p>
